Guidelines for Abstract submission (Panels)

1. About the autorship:

a) Proposals could be presented by:

  • Professors
  • Masters and Doctoral postgraduates
  • Researchers with bachelor’s degree
  • Undergraduate students with in co-autorship with a professor or adviser

b) Each author may submit maximum ONE proposal as the main author
c) Each proposal may have a maximum of three authors.

GUIDELINES FOR AUTHORS:

2. Guidelines for Abstract’s submission in Panels:

a) Abstracts must be submitted through a specific website: Call for Submissions (Chamada para Submissões). In the first access you must register your personal data. When accessing the website, after the initial instructions you will find a link “Click here to start the Submission”
b) Choose your Panel in “Conference Modalities” (“Modalidades da Conferência“) and follow the “Guidelines” (“Diretrizes”) and “Copyright Statement” (“Declaração de Direitos Autorais”).
c) Add the data of the authors: full name, electronic address, Institution; country of origin and a brief biographical summary.
d) Repeat this process for each co-author
e) Add your proposal’s title and abstract in the choosen Panel (“Seminário de Pesquisa“)

Note: the Abstract should have 300 words and contain the following elements: subject, objectives, methodological data, theoretical interpretative paradigm and results achieved

3. Metadata for Proposal Indexing

a) Include key-words (between 3-5 words) and the proposal’s metadata with information about which Latin America Region and Countries you research (example: South America, Andean Countries, Mercosur etc).
b) Proposals must be of regional relevance. For this purpose, proposals should address (i) Latin America as a whole or a subcontinent’s region; (ii) themes that cover two or more region’s countries.
c) Proposals must be written in Portuguese, Spanish or English.
